What is the Shrine System in Diablo 4?
Before diving into the specifics of how t o "Give Thanks" at the shrine, it's important to u nderstand the mechanics of shrines in Diablo 4.
Shrines are scattered throughout the game world, hidden in various areas. They are often lo cated in remote and dangerous places, requiring pl ayers to fight off enemies and navigate the world carefully. Each shrine represents a form of revere nce toward the different deities, spirits, and pow ers within the Diablo universe. While some shrines are tied to the Covenants, others are more neutra l, offering generic buffs or blessings that affect the player's stats.
